Iowa (IA) contains 934 ZIP codes spread across 100 counties and 890 distinct cities. Together those ZIP areas cover a total population of 3,046,945 based on Census ACS 5-Year Estimates. ZIP-level granularity matters here: Iowa stretches across very different economic zones, and a single state-wide average hides the 10x spread you will see between its highest-income and lowest-income ZIP codes in the table below.

The economic baseline across Iowa ZIPs shows an average median household income of $76,594 and an average home value of $175,588, with a state-wide average median age of 43.6. These averages are computed over every ZIP in IA with reported data, not weighted by population, so small rural ZIPs count the same as metropolitan ones. Use them as a reference line, then drill into the ZIP tables to see where affluent suburbs, rural counties, and urban cores deviate from the state mean.

The largest urban concentrations in Iowa by population are Des Moines, Cedar Rapids, Davenport, Sioux City, Iowa City, and each city aggregates multiple ZIP codes worth of Census data on its own city page. Frequently Asked Questions

How many ZIP codes are in Iowa?
Iowa has 934 ZIP codes across 100 counties, with a total population of 3,046,945.
What is the average income in Iowa?
The average median household income across Iowa ZIP codes is $76,594. The average home value is $175,588.
What are the largest cities in Iowa?
The largest cities in Iowa by population include Des Moines (212,318), Cedar Rapids (134,152), Davenport (102,516), Sioux City (85,884), Iowa City (77,509).
